Understanding this legal service

Guardianship involves appointing someone to make personal decisions for someone who cannot do so.

Conservatorship covers handling financial affairs and property management on behalf of a protected person.

Definition and explanation

These proceedings are court supervised and require filings, notices, and hearings to establish guardianship or conservatorship.

Key elements and court processes

Each case involves petitioning the court, evaluating capacity, appointing a guardian or conservator, and setting limits with oversight.

Key Terms and Glossary

Essential terms related to guardianship and conservatorship provide clarity for families.

Guardianship

A legal process to appoint a person to make personal and health decisions for someone who cannot make them.

Conservatorship

A legal arrangement to manage financial affairs for an incapacitated person.

Incapacity

A condition where a person cannot make safe or informed decisions.

Petition

A formal request filed with the court to start a guardianship or conservatorship case.

Comparison of legal options

There are alternative routes to protect a loved one, including supported decision making, powers of attorney, or conservatorship under different terms.

What is guardianship and conservatorship?

A guardian is appointed to make personal decisions for someone who cannot make them. A conservator handles financial affairs and property management for the protected person.
